What does MI stand for in MI Homes?

​M/I Homes stands for Melvin and Irving Schottenstein – two cousins from Columbus, Ohio that previously developed thousands of apartments, and pioneered the development of one of Central Ohio’s first golf course communities before they entered the home building business.

How long does it take to build a house Michigan?

“If someone wants to build a 9,000-square-foot custom home, it could take 24 months to complete, while a smaller 2,000-square-foot home will likely be completed in around six months,” said Mike Stoskopf, executive director of the Home Builders Association of Southeastern Michigan, builders.org.

Who Builds Next Gen homes in Florida?

Lennar’s
Lennar’s Next Gen home designs are appealing to many residents of Southwest Florida. There are two floor plans: The Liberation and Independence. Each floor plan offers separate living quarters for either an active or elderly adult, and their adult children.

Is it cheaper to build or buy a house in Michigan?

Is it worth it to build a house in Michigan? The bottom line: it’s more expensive to build a house in Michigan than to buy one. The average home value in Michigan is $222,659, according to Zillow. That’s solidly below the average estimated cost to build a house, which varies between $225,000 and $265,000.

  • Who started MI Homes?

    Irving and Melvin Schottenstein
    Founded in 1976 by Irving and Melvin Schottenstein, and guided by Irving’s drive to always “treat the customer right,” we’ve fulfilled the dreams of over 140,000 homeowners and grown to become one of the nation’s leading homebuilders.

    What is a Multigen home?

    The U.S Census Bureau defines a multigenerational home as a household that consists of more than two adult generations living under the same roof or grandparents living with grandchildren under the age of 25. Put simply, these homes exist somewhere between a single-family home and a multi-family building.

    What is next gen home within a home?

    The Home Within a Home® Next Gen is a home within a home that offers a separate entrance, kitchenette, living area, a bedroom or multi-use room, and a bathroom.
